How much do cleaning experience j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for cleaning experience in the United States is $16.84,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.42 and $18.51 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is cleaning experience?

Cleaning experience refers to the skills and knowledge gained from performing cleaning tasks in various environments, such as homes, offices, hotels, or hospitals. This experience usually involves using cleaning products and equipment, following safety protocols, and maintaining high standards of hygiene and organization. People with cleaning experience are often familiar with different types of surfaces and know the best methods to clean and sanitize each. Employers value cleaning experience because it demonstrates reliability, attention to detail, and the ability to work independently or as part of a team.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in a cleaning role, and why are they important?

To thrive in a cleaning role, you need attention to detail, knowledge of cleaning techniques, and an understanding of health and safety protocols, often with prior experience or basic training preferred. Familiarity with cleaning equipment, chemicals, and safety data sheets (SDS) is typically required. Reliability, time management, and good communication skills help cleaners work efficiently and collaborate with clients or team members. These abilities ensure safe, thorough cleaning that meets hygiene standards and client expectations.

What are some common challenges faced by cleaning professionals and how can they be managed on the job?

Cleaning professionals often encounter challenges such as managing time efficiently to meet tight schedules, handling strong cleaning chemicals safely, and working in environments that may be physically demanding. Effective communication with supervisors and clients can help clarify expectations and prioritize tasks. Additionally, staying up to date with safety protocols and using proper equipment can minimize risks and improve job performance, making the workday smoother and more productive.

What is the difference between Cleaning Experience vs Housekeeper?

AspectCleaning ExperienceHousekeeper
Required CredentialsNone specific, on-the-job skillsMay require basic training or certifications
Work EnvironmentVarious settings, including commercial and residentialPrimarily residential or hospitality settings
Employer UsageUsed broadly for any cleaning-related roleSpecific role involving cleaning and household management
Common Search IntentLooking for cleaning skills or experienceSeeking a job as a housekeeper or domestic worker

Cleaning Experience refers to the skills gained through various cleaning tasks, applicable across multiple settings. A Housekeeper typically performs cleaning along with additional household duties, often in residential or hospitality environments. While both roles involve cleaning, Housekeeper positions usually require a broader skill set related to household management.

What You'll Do

As a Cleaning Specialist, you will help keep offices and commercial buildings clean, safe, and welcoming. Your daily tasks include:

  • Clean offices, hallways, conference rooms, and common areas.

  • Clean and sanitize restrooms.

  • Refill soap, paper towels, and other restroom supplies.

  • Vacuum carpets and sweep or mop hard floors.

  • Dust furniture, desks, and other surfaces.

  • Empty trash and recycling containers.

  • Disinfect high-touch areas.

  • Follow company cleaning and safety procedures.

  • Complete your assigned work on time and with care.
